Beyond Automation: Reshaping the Patient Journey

The impact extends beyond back-office efficiency. One of the most striking features of HealthOps AI Suite is its ability to reduce patient wait times by 30%. This isn’t achieved through simply scheduling more appointments. Instead, the AI intelligently optimizes scheduling based on appointment type, physician availability, and even predicted patient no-show rates. It dynamically adjusts schedules in real-time, factoring in unexpected delays or urgent cases.

Consider a busy emergency room. Traditionally, triage nurses spend a significant amount of time gathering basic patient information. HealthOps AI Suite integrates with patient portals and utilizes conversational AI to pre-screen patients before they even arrive, collecting key details about their symptoms and medical history. This information is then seamlessly integrated into the Electronic Health Record (EHR), giving physicians a head start and streamlining the initial assessment process. The result? Faster, more informed decisions and reduced congestion in the waiting room.

The platform also includes predictive analytics that identify potential bottlenecks in the patient flow. For example, it can forecast peak hours in the radiology department and proactively adjust staffing levels to prevent delays. This proactive approach is a significant departure from the reactive, fire-fighting mode that characterizes many healthcare facilities.

A Realistic Outlook: It’s Not a Silver Bullet

While HealthOps AI Suite offers a compelling vision for the future of healthcare operations, it’s important to be realistic. The platform requires a significant upfront investment in implementation and training. Furthermore, the AI is only as good as the data it’s trained on. Healthcare organizations will need to ensure their data is clean, accurate, and representative of their patient population to achieve optimal results.

The platform also doesn’t solve the fundamental challenges of healthcare – things like physician burnout or systemic inequities. It’s a powerful tool, but it needs to be deployed strategically and ethically, with a focus on enhancing, not replacing, the human element of care.
